Man United pip Arsenal to signing of Welsh wonderkid Adam Matthews

Sir Alex Ferguson has got revenge on Arsene Wenger after Manchester United wrapped up a deal to sign 17-year-old Welsh wonder Adam Matthews.United were famously left with egg on their face when they announced the signing of former Cardiff City midfielder Aaron Ramsey before the player opted to join Wenger at Arsenal in 2008. The deal for Matthew cannot go through until the transfer window opens in January but it is expected to hit any last-minute snags. Arsenal were thought to be interested in the defender, but Ferguson moved quickly in securing the Welsh wonder's signature.Matthews, who has made 12 Championship starts for the Bluebirds, will cost United £5million with further payments to follow as the Swansea-born player progresses through their ranks.
